Transaction 28620580bd11c4a57c442cc40d9cd277db74caf6da18d5f7ac65e096e9d93431

1 Input
2 Outputs
  • 28620580bd11c4a57c442cc40d9cd277db74caf6da18d5f7ac65e096e9d93431:0
  • value  28477
    address  1KSxiuw5ZxxBZTgbXg4EJxjH6VVrHeZSzY
  • 28620580bd11c4a57c442cc40d9cd277db74caf6da18d5f7ac65e096e9d93431:1
  • value  1665695
    address  3CtndyUnSyyjCTSXocPtfLVYVfvhqddZ8M